Venice: One exhibition, two locations

The Gallerie dell'Accademia in Venice is dedicating a comprehensive exhibition to Indian-British artist Anish Kapoor beginning April 20th. This looks at both older and new works by the pioneering artist. In addition to the museum, the exhibition will also be on view at the historic Palazzo Manfrin.

Paris: Shirley Jaffe and León Ferrari at the Centre Pompidou

The Centre Pompidou in Paris is showing two new temporary exhibitions from 20 April. In the Galerie d'art graphique and the Galerie du Musée, the abstract art of the American painter Shirley Jaffe can be seen, while the Galerie 0 and the Espace prospectif make room for the art of the Argentinean Léon Ferrari.

New York MoMA shows photographs by female artists

The exhibition Our Selves: Photographs by Women Artists from Helen Kornblum at MoMA explores the connections between photography, feminism, civil rights, indigenous sovereignty, and queer liberation. Those who enjoy exploring themes of equality and diversity can look forward to an impressive show of work beginning April 16.

Christie's auction in May

Andy Warhol's portraits of Marilyn Monroe are world famous. Now one of them will be auctioned at Christie's in May: Shot Sage Blue Marilyn is estimated at around $200 million − that would be a new record price.

Venice Biennale 2022

Following a petition by nearly 400 people in the Namibian art community who feel their country is not adequately represented, the pavilion's main funder is pulling out. RENN, who staffs the pavilion, is a white male, resident of South Africa, who is known less as an artist than as a tourism industry worker.

Tokyo: National Art Center

Until May 23, the National Art Center in Tokyo presents the exhibition Damien Hirst, Cherry Blossoms. It features 24 large-scale paintings from the artist's eponymous series depicting a group of colorful, dynamic landscapes.

Turner Prize 2022

The four nominees for the Turner Prize, one of the most prestigious art awards in the world, have been announced: Heather Phillipson, Ingrid Pollard, Veronica Ryan, and Sin Wai Kin. The exhibition with the works of these artists will be held at Tate Liverpool for the first time in 15 years.

Italy's leading contemporary art fair

The application deadlines for the coveted art fair ARTIMISSIMA  end in May. The deadline for the Main Section, Monologue/Dialogue, New Entries, Art Spaces & Editions is May 25, and for Present Future, Back to the Future, Disegni is already May 10. The 29th edition of ARTIMISSIMA, for the first time under the direction of Luigi Fassi, will take place from November 4 to 6, 2022.

»Louise Bourgeois: Paintings« at the Metropolitan Museum of Art

Louise Bourgeois − a famous sculptor of the 20th century, known for her experiments with installations and her huge bronze spider sculptures. Starting April 12, the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York is devoting Louise Bourgeois: Paintings to the artist's early paintings, in which important motifs of her œuvre can already be seen.
